Ibricic: “Zeljo called me, and I’m always ready for Hajduk”

Published December 27, 2015
Share
SHARE

ibricic2The former player of the national football team of B&H is weighing offers for continuation of his career, and he revealed that Zeljeznicar was the first one to call him.

“I broke my contract in Turkey, and now I’m a free player. I’m taking offers, I have couple of options. Zeljeznicar was the first one to call me, but nothing is definite yet,” said Ibricic for dalmatinskiportal.hr, adding that he would be very happy to return to Hajduk.

“Everyone is talking about that. So far nobody contacted me, but there is time. We’ll see. I am always ready to put on a white jersey, especially now since there are no more obstacles. I’m free, I’m ready for negotiations with everyone, especially with Hajduk,” added Ibricic.

Ibricic was playing for Hajduk from 2008 to 2011.
